Sergeant First Class (SFC)
Duane E. Whitaker enlisted in the Army in June of 1984 and attended
Basic Training at Fort Jackson, South Carolina. He moved to
Fort Gordon, Georgia for Advanced Individual Training and later
reclassified to a Food Service Specialist in 1988.
SFC Whitaker has
served in several duty and leadership positions from Platoon
Sergeant to Dining Facility Manager in his career field over the
last twenty years. He has served in the 9th
Infantry Division, 3rd Armored Division, 3/47 Infantry,
1/509th Infantry (OPFOR), 1/508 ABCT, 5th
Special Forces Group, and the 82nd Airborne Division.
He served tow
overseas tours (Friedberg, Germany and Vicenza, Italy) and three
combat tours (Operation Desert Storm, Operation Enduring Freedom,
and Operation Iraqi Freedom).
His military
education includes: Primary Leadership and Development Course
(Warrior Leader’s Course), Basic Noncommissioned Officer’s Course,
Advanced Noncommissioned Officer’s Course, Airborne School, and Air
Assault School.
SFC Whitaker’s awards
and decorations include the Bronze Star Medal, Meritorious Service
Medal w/2 OLC, the Army Commendation Medal w/2 OLC, the Army
Achievement Medal w/4 OLC, Good Conduct Medal 6th Award,
the National Defense Service Medal w/2 OLC, the Global War on
Terrorism Expeditionary Medal, the Global War on Terrorism Service
Medal, and the Southwest Asia Service Medal w/2 OLC.
